BSc Geography
The Geography program at Portland State University gives students an appreciation and understanding of the human environment on global, regional, and local scales. It provides background and requisite training for careers in resource, planning, environmental, or education fields.

Coursework emphasizes systematic and regional approaches to understanding the physical environment and human-environment interactions. Techniques classes in GIS, remote sensing, spatial analysis, and cartography) provide the tools to analyze complex local, regional, and global phenomena.
Geography majors find work in urban and natural resource management, spatial and GIS analysis, urban planning, map design and production and statistical analysis. Geography is the lead department on campus for training in GIS, remote sensing, cartography, and spatial analysis.
